Traugott Richard captured the festive atmosphere of the Eidgenössisches Schützenfest in Zurich using an albumen print, a popular photographic process of the time. This image provides a window into a specific cultural moment, reflecting Switzerland's national identity and the importance placed on marksmanship. During the 19th century, shooting festivals were significant social and political events that fostered a sense of unity among the Swiss cantons, at a time when national identity was being negotiated.
